Two sources of free radicals (lycopene)


Free radicals ( Lycopene Oil ) are unpaired atoms or functional groups containing a kind of instantaneous electronic form, prevalent in biological systems. The presence of free radicals in vivo animal has two kinds of different sources,

One is the exogenous free radical instant fruit drink powder in the environment of high temperature, radiation, photodegradation, chemical substances cause.

The two is the endogenous free radical production in various metabolic reactions. The endogenous free radical is the main source of animal body free radical ( lycopene ).

Bio-Safety of astaxanthin

The use of chemical synthesis of astaxanthin means  inevitably introduce the impurity of chemical substances, such as generating in the process of synthesis of non natural by-products, will reduce its bioavailability safety.

  With the rise of natural astaxanthin, countries in the world on the management of the chemical synthesis of astaxanthin is more and more strict, such as USA the food and Drug Administration (FDA),which have banned the chemical synthesis of astaxanthin into foods and dietary supplements (Supplements) market.

  Natural astaxanthin made general security authentication in FDA (GRAS), can legitimately into foods and dietary supplements on the market.

  Astaxanthin production tend to develop natural astaxanthin biological (plant) sources, thus make large-scale production.

The lower stability of synthetic astaxanthin


The stability and antioxidant activity of synthetic astaxanthin is lower than natural astaxanthin . Because astaxanthin molecular ends of the hydroxyl (-OH) can be esterified led to its stability is not the same.

  There are more than 90% natural astaxanthin ester form, so more stable.Astaxanthin synthesis in the free state in the presence of stability is not the same, therefore, astaxanthin synthesis must make embedding to stability.

  Synthesis of astaxanthin as left-handed structure is only about 1/4, so its antioxidant activity is only natural about 1/4.

what 's the key role of haematococcus pluvialis

Haematococcus pluvialis ability to adapt to the environment is extremely strong.Under appropriate growth conditions, it takes the flagellated swarmer cell for rapid growth and reproduction.When the condition becomes severe, motile cells of Haematococcus pluvialis will lose their flagella, cell wall thickening, accumulation of a large number of substances and red cells, which entered the A state of dormancy.

  After dormant for 40 years the cells are still activated, in suitable conditions, can multiply to produce new green cells. The tenacious vitality and the environmental adaptability of Haematococcus pluvialis sparked great interest to the scientific community, scientists speculated, the red material of Haematococcus pluvialis cells may play a key role .
